If your toilet system is an older or septic system these liners will require soaking … WebDec 24, 2024 · Try to pull the diaper out by hand. Use a coat hanger or tool to grab the diaper out. Use a toilet or closet auger to pull the diaper out or break it up. Plunge the toilet to force the pieces down the line. Try a test flush. As a last resort, pull the toilet or call the plumber. Adults who prefer pull-on style products or who manage urinary incontinence, should consider GoSupreme. suzy juliana at\u0026tWebJun 5, 2014 · gDiaper is a hybrid style diaper, so the cover can be combined with different insert options. It has three parts: the gPant cover, an elastic edged, waterproofed, breathable gPouch which snaps-into the gPant, and an insert which gets tucked into the gPouch. We tested their gCloth insert made from polyester microfleece, hemp and cotton. barselona orai
